Understanding Firearms Regulations in Southport, NC
When you're looking into shooting in Southport, North Carolina, one of the most critical aspects to understand is the firearms regulations. North Carolina has specific laws regarding the purchase, ownership, and use of firearms, and Southport adheres to these state-level regulations, often with local ordinances that add further detail. For instance, understanding concealed carry permits, open carry laws, and restrictions on certain types of firearms is paramount for anyone engaging in shooting activities. It's not just about knowing where you can shoot, but also how and what you can shoot. The state generally allows for the purchase of rifles and shotguns by individuals 18 and older, and handguns by those 21 and older, provided they meet certain criteria and pass background checks. When it comes to shooting in Southport, North Carolina, especially in public areas or designated ranges, there are often rules about noise, safe handling, and ensuring ammunition is appropriate for the intended use. Many responsible gun owners in Southport actively seek out information to ensure they are compliant with all laws. This includes understanding federal laws as well, such as the National Firearms Act (NFA), which regulates certain types of firearms. We're talking about things like automatic weapons, short-barreled rifles, and silencers. So, if your idea of shooting involves these, you've got a whole other layer of regulations to navigate. Safe Shooting Practices in Southport
Alright, let's talk about the absolute non-negotiables when it comes to shooting in Southport, North Carolina: safe shooting practices. Whether you're at a formal shooting range or engaging in permitted activities in designated outdoor areas, safety is paramount. When you're out there, guys, always remember the four fundamental rules of firearm safety: Treat every firearm as if it were loaded; Never point the muzzle at anything you are not willing to destroy; Keep your finger off the trigger until your sights are on the target and you have decided to fire; and Be sure of your target and what is beyond it. These aren't just suggestions; they are the bedrock of responsible gun ownership and shooting in Southport, North Carolina. For those new to shooting, or even seasoned pros, taking a firearm safety course is highly recommended. These courses provide in-depth knowledge on safe handling, storage, cleaning, and the laws pertaining to firearms in North Carolina. Understanding your firearm inside and out is also key. Make sure you know how to operate it safely, how to clear malfunctions, and how to maintain it properly. Ammunition is another critical factor. Using the correct ammunition for your specific firearm is vital; using the wrong type can lead to dangerous malfunctions. Always store your firearms and ammunition securely and separately, especially if there are children in the household. The goal is to prevent unauthorized access. When you're out practicing shooting in Southport, North Carolina, always wear appropriate eye and ear protection. The noise from firearms can cause permanent hearing damage, and stray projectiles can cause serious eye injuries. Furthermore, be aware of your surroundings. Ensure you have a safe backstop that will stop any missed shots and prevent them from ricocheting or hitting unintended targets. This is especially important in outdoor settings where terrain can be unpredictable.
